News: Group forms to save Ghost Town

Posted at 1:28 PM EDT (1728 GMT)

Oct. 6th, 2004 -- A group of business leaders in North Carolina have formed a non-profit group to save the Maggie Valley theme park, Ghost Town in the Sky. The group is seeking around $70,000 to develop a plan to attract a buyer.

If a buyer doesn't surface, then the group syas they will try to get enough money to buy the park themselves. Their goal is to re-open the park by any means. Since Ghost Town's closing, many businesses have suffered.
